CVE-2012-0151
Microsoft Windows Authenticode Signature Verification Remote Code Execution Vulnerability - [Actively Exploited]
Description
The Authenticode Signature Verification function in Microsoft Windows XP SP2 and SP3, Windows Server 2003 SP2, Windows Vista SP2, Windows Server 2008 SP2, R2, and R2 SP1, Windows 7 Gold and SP1, and Windows 8 Consumer Preview does not properly validate the digest of a signed portable executable (PE) file, which allows user-assisted rem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a modified file with additional content, aka "WinVerifyTrust Signature Validation Vulnerability."

Solution
- Microsoft has released a set of patches for Windows XP, 2003, Vista, 2008, 7, and 2008 R2.
